Core Insights - The energy supply security in China has shown remarkable resilience, achieving the best performance since the 14th Five-Year Plan, with non-fossil energy consumption exceeding the 20% target [1][2] Group 1: Energy Production and Consumption - Total electricity consumption in China is expected to exceed 10 trillion kilowatt-hours for the first time, with July and August seeing consumption surpassing 1 trillion kilowatt-hours, marking a global first [1] - Oil and gas production reached historical highs, with crude oil production at approximately 215 million tons and natural gas production exceeding 260 billion cubic meters, marking a continuous increase of over 10 billion cubic meters for nine consecutive years [1] - The self-sufficiency rate of energy has increased from around 80% to over 84% during the 14th Five-Year Plan, with coal and electricity supply levels being world-class [2] Group 2: Renewable Energy Development - The first batch of wind and solar power bases has been completed, with the second and third batches adding approximately 50 million kilowatts of capacity [2] - By 2030, the proportion of renewable energy generation capacity is expected to exceed 50%, with non-fossil energy consumption reaching 25% [3] - The total installed capacity of hydropower has surpassed 440 million kilowatts, with pumped storage capacity exceeding 64 million kilowatts [2] Group 3: Market and Infrastructure - The construction of a unified national electricity market has made significant progress, with 28 provinces engaging in electricity spot trading, and the southern region becoming the largest unified clearing electricity market globally [2] - The expected market-based electricity trading volume for the year is 6.6 trillion kilowatt-hours, a year-on-year increase of 6.8%, accounting for 64% of total electricity consumption [2] Group 4: Innovation and Future Outlook - The integration of artificial intelligence with the energy sector is advancing, with over 10 million kilowatts of new energy storage capacity installed, representing over 40% of the global total [6] - The production capacity of renewable hydrogen has exceeded 220,000 tons, accounting for more than half of the global total, while green ammonia and methanol production capacity is approximately 1 million tons [6] - Future tasks include developing hydrogen energy industry plans and supporting the research and development of advanced nuclear technologies [6]

西藏那曲地热供暖覆盖145万平方米,居民告别烧煤取暖
Xin Hua She· 2025-12-17 02:00
Group 1 - The average heating season in Naqu, Tibet lasts for 7 months, with an average annual temperature close to zero degrees Celsius, making heating a significant aspect of living quality [1] - The implementation of geothermal centralized heating has allowed residents to maintain indoor temperatures around 20 degrees Celsius without burning coal, resulting in cost savings [1] - The government subsidy reduces the heating cost to 13 yuan per square meter for the heating season, alleviating the financial burden on residents [1] Group 2 - The "Naqu City Southern New Town Clean Energy Centralized Heating Pilot Project" is one of seven pilot projects aimed at promoting green and low-carbon heating solutions [1] - The geothermal resource in Tibet is characterized by high water temperature and sufficient heat, with a focus on protecting underground heat reservoirs and avoiding corrosion of municipal pipelines [2] - The development of geothermal resources is environmentally significant, achieving zero pollution and zero emissions compared to traditional coal energy [2] - The Naqu Ecological Environment Bureau has actively promoted clean energy applications, resulting in the elimination of 313 coal-fired boilers to improve urban living conditions [2] - Geothermal resources in Naqu have high development value, with potential applications in electricity generation, agriculture, and aquaculture, providing stable heat sources for greenhouses and livestock facilities [2]
完善四个机制,推动新能源产业从规模扩张到质量提升
Zhong Guo Huan Jing Bao· 2025-12-16 23:28
笔者认为,造成新能源产业发展乱象的原因,在于监管机制没有跟上行业的高速发展,各地激励政策集 中出台,而规范约束体系却存在短板。一是准入审核机制宽松,部分地区重审批速度轻实质核验。企业 无需落实电网接入方案、资金保障等核心条件即可获批,导致大量投机项目出现。二是动态监管机制缺 失,项目审批后缺乏全周期跟踪管理,对投资进度、股权变更等关键环节管控薄弱,给圈地占位倒卖指 标留下空间。三是规划协同机制不健全,新能源项目与国土空间规划、电网建设规划衔接脱节,接网工 程滞后、消纳场景不足等问题导致项目难以落地。四是惩戒问责机制偏软,对违规企业处罚力度不够, 监管履职不到位等问题未得到有效追责,难以形成震慑效应。 新能源产业的健康发展是保障国家能源安全与落实"双碳"战略的重要基础,"十五五"规划建议也提出了 加快建设新型能源体系总要求。笔者以为,各地应结合本地实际,借鉴先进地区经验和做法,完善相关 机制,构建系统完备、协同高效的新能源建设发展制度体系,从根本上遏制新能源产业发展中的乱象, 推动新能源产业从规模扩张向质量提升转型。 健全刚性准入机制。推行"并联审批+实质性审核"模式,将环评、用地、接网等手续同步办理、限时办 ...
林伯强:以互促循环打造AI时代能源强国
Huan Qiu Wang Zi Xun· 2025-12-16 22:56
来源:环球时报 当前,人工智能(AI)技术正飞速发展,其应用范围不断拓展,深刻改变着社会生产生活各个方面。 与此同时,全球能源体系也在经历深刻变革,清洁能源转型成为时代主题,满足AI能源需求已进入"如 何低碳""如何兼顾AI发展和应对气候变化"的新阶段。 但如果围绕二者的"痛点",打造一个互促的循环,AI也可能为清洁能源转型提供前所未有的机遇和解决 方案,加速形成新型能源体系。首先,在发电端,多模态大模型通过融合气象、遥感、历史运行等多源 异构数据,显著提升新能源出力预测精度,覆盖水电、风电、光伏等新能源及火电、核电、煤炭等传统 能源领域,为源端优化提供精准支撑。其次,在电网运行层面,智能巡检、调度与故障自愈系统大幅提 升运维效率与电网韧性,助力"源网荷储一体化"建设。最后,在需求侧,智慧能源管理系统可以实现负 荷精细化调控,储能智能化运营与车网互动技术则可将能源消费转化为电网灵活资源,重塑能源价值 链。 值得注意的是,"完善人工智能治理"是AI与能源融合的前提和保障。当前AI在能源领域应用仍面临数据 基础薄弱、大模型"黑箱"等问题,尤其在核电站安全决策、电网实时调度等核心场景,对算法可解释性 与可靠性要求极 ...
